Quiz Builder practice

Filter by difficulty, use hints, reveal solutions and save attempts locally.

1. Practice Quiz Builder overview by building one step of a small real project feature and checking the result.

code-writing
beginnerQuiz Builder overview

1. Start from the Quiz Builder overview l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

2. Practice Quiz Builder setup by building one step of a small real project feature and checking the result.

code-fix
beginnerQuiz Builder setup

1. Start from the Quiz Builder setup l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

3. Practice Quiz Builder syntax by building one step of a small real project feature and checking the result.

output
beginnerQuiz Builder syntax

1. Start from the Quiz Builder syntax l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

4. Practice Quiz Builder examples by building one step of a small real project feature and checking the result.

fill-blank
beginnerQuiz Builder examples

1. Start from the Quiz Builder examples l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

5. Practice Quiz Builder workflow by building one step of a small real project feature and checking the result.

true-false
beginnerQuiz Builder workflow

1. Start from the Quiz Builder workflow l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

6. Practice Quiz Builder validation by building one step of a small real project feature and checking the result.

mini-project
beginnerQuiz Builder validation

1. Start from the Quiz Builder validation l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

7. Practice Quiz Builder debugging by building one step of a small real project feature and checking the result.

mcq
beginnerQuiz Builder debugging

1. Start from the Quiz Builder debugging l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

8. Practice Quiz Builder best practices by building one step of a small real project feature and checking the result.

code-writing
beginnerQuiz Builder best practices

1. Start from the Quiz Builder best practices l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

9. Practice Quiz Builder overview by building one step of a small real project feature and checking the result.

code-fix
beginnerQuiz Builder overview

1. Start from the Quiz Builder overview l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

10. Practice Quiz Builder setup by building one step of a small real project feature and checking the result.

output
beginnerQuiz Builder setup

1. Start from the Quiz Builder setup l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

11. Practice Quiz Builder syntax by building one step of a small real project feature and checking the result.

fill-blank
intermediateQuiz Builder syntax

1. Start from the Quiz Builder syntax l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

12. Practice Quiz Builder examples by building one step of a small real project feature and checking the result.

true-false
intermediateQuiz Builder examples

1. Start from the Quiz Builder examples l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

13. Practice Quiz Builder workflow by building one step of a small real project feature and checking the result.

mini-project
intermediateQuiz Builder workflow

1. Start from the Quiz Builder workflow l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

14. Practice Quiz Builder validation by building one step of a small real project feature and checking the result.

mcq
intermediateQuiz Builder validation

1. Start from the Quiz Builder validation l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

15. Practice Quiz Builder debugging by building one step of a small real project feature and checking the result.

code-writing
intermediateQuiz Builder debugging

1. Start from the Quiz Builder debugging l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

16. Practice Quiz Builder best practices by building one step of a small real project feature and checking the result.

code-fix
intermediateQuiz Builder best practices

1. Start from the Quiz Builder best practices l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

17. Practice Quiz Builder overview by building one step of a small real project feature and checking the result.

output
intermediateQuiz Builder overview

1. Start from the Quiz Builder overview l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.

18. Practice Quiz Builder setup by building one step of a small real project feature and checking the result.

fill-blank
intermediateQuiz Builder setup

1. Start from the Quiz Builder setup lesson example.

2. Use sample input, output and edge cases instead of placeholder text.

3. Run the example and compare output before polishing.